It does indeed sound like migraines. Have you changed your diet? If so, that's probably the culprit. A lot of people get migraines if they skip a meal, especially breakfast.
...and like meganhead said, stress and allergies can also bring them on. If you think it's stress related, learn relaxation excercises. Also, if you sense a migraine starting to come on, drink some coffee or tea. The caffiene helps to reduce/prevent them.
there are so many causes for headaches...stress, alergies, hormones, etc. But if you have been experiencing them daily, I would def go see a doc. Your quality of life sounds like it is being severly affected! a doc can help you get to the bottom of it, prescribe appropriate meds if necessary, and restore your quality of life, as well as give you reassurance that it may not be something more serious. AND, even if they are migraines there are new meds out there that can knock one out! Good luck and I hope you feel better!
